Following up on adding blackwork to the spot sampler, I thought I’d post some of the simple patterns I doodled for the lesson on blackwork.

The first one here is a leafy corner, just in time for autumn (on this side of the world). Of course, if you imagine the leaves green, it could also be just in time for spring and summer!

Free Blackwork Design: Autumn Leaves on a Corner

If worked in the Hobein stitch (or double or reverse running stitch), the design will come out the same on the front and the back of the fabric, which makes these kinds of patterns great for table linens and other items where the back is not covered.

The design is a relatively simple linear blackwork design. It works up fairly quickly, once you have the hang of the stitch sequence.

The side patterns can be repeated as many times as you like, to extend them along the edge of a piece.
